Suggested Changes:

Motherboard: Gigabyte GA-965P-DS3 This one will support Conroe out of the box.

CPU Cooler: Drop it. This chip won't need an aftermarket cooler unless you're going to be overclocking by more than 800Mhz.

Video Card: With the DX 10 cards just around the corner, the 7950GX2 is a complete waste of money. Never spend over $400 on a part you're going to use for 6 months at most. Get the eVGA Geforce 7600GT instead.

PSU: Antec Truepower 430W <--- This is all you're going to need if you take my suggestions.

Hard Drives: Like ikjadoon said, the Seagate 320GB 7200.10 drives are better performers than the WD's are. Switch to the Seagate Barracuda 7200.10 320GB SATA2
